Output 69990bc5630b02ee373385f0a10c2b8a83b616c8bd76bb668756b9b29cf489d6:0

value
22655417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 435b9e083a784ab5cf8723f82c9bb40afb84f870 OP_EQUAL
address
ME3KFxwe8CunBd9Y8YqU5b4ribxXaWmAwh
transaction
69990bc5630b02ee373385f0a10c2b8a83b616c8bd76bb668756b9b29cf489d6
spent
true